What I learned from these world cinema Masters at Qumra 2025

E. Nina Rothe April 14, 2025

From Walter Salles it was about the power of kindness, from Darius Khondji it turned out to be about our individual learning pace and from Anna Terrazas, a lesson in adaptability… Among others. Read on for all the important lessons I learned at this year’s annual DFI industry incubator.

Berlinale announces 2024 juries and expresses solidarity with travel-banned Iranian filmmakers

E. Nina Rothe February 1, 2024

A multitalented group of people will decide who brings home the top prizes from Berlin, while Iran shows its colors.
